Activity Overview
 Boomerang Bay is a water park located within Carowinds, a large amusement park in Charlotte, North Carolina. Its wide range of fun water-based activities make it a popular summer attraction for families wanting to escape the heat. Attractions include numerous water slides, two huge wave pools, a water jungle gym, special play areas for toddlers, and several family tube rides.
 Things to Do
  - Go swimming in the Great Barrier Reef or Bondi Beach attractions, two large wave pools that will make you feel like you're visiting the ocean.
  - Take your child to the Jackaroo Landing, a three-story water jungle gym where kids can use water sprayers to soak each other or stand under a huge bucket that dumps 1,000 gallons of water every few minutes!
  - Grab a tube and go for a leisurely float around the 1,000-foot long Crocodile Run lazy river attraction.
  - Visit Kookaburra Bay or Kangaroo Lagoon and Wallaby Wharf with your infant or toddler in order to enjoy age-appropriate water play areas.
 
 Boomerang Bay Insider Tips
  - Don't miss the water slides! If you enjoy the thrill of enclosed water slides then you'll want to tackle Pipeline Peak, which features two body slides and two tube slides.
  - If your child isn't a strong swimmer, you can pick up a complimentary life jacket for them to use while they play in the water.
  - Admission to Boomerang Bay is included in the price of admission to Carowinds, so you might as well spend some time enjoying the rides in the amusement park too!
